Moscow Mule
The Moscow Mule was conceived in Manhattan in 1941 and since those wartime days has been lifting spirits with the classic combination of aromatic ginger beer, fresh lime juice, and a vodka kick.
150ml Kingsdown Ginger Beer
50ml Stolichnaya Vodka
5ml fresh lime juice
Pour the vodka, lime juice, and Kingsdown Ginger Beer into a highball glass, add lots of ice and a sprig of mint, serve.

Long White Lady
150ml Kingsdown Cloudy Lemonade
50ml Plymouth Gin
50ml Cointreau
1 egg white
Pour the gin, Cointreau, and egg white into a cocktail shaker with ice, shake hard, strain into a highball glass, top up with Kingsdown Cloudy Lemonade, add lots of ice and a twist of lemon, serve.
